A very weird thing is happening with my RX 480 8GB. Overclocking memory gives me this:

Setting DAG epoch #201 for GPU0
Create GPU buffer for GPU0

And then reporting continuously 0.000 Mh/s. Any alteration to -mclock other than the value 2000, which is what the default clock is set to, will cause 0.000 Mh/s.

I have 5 other RX 580 cards running just fine on the same rig. Ample amount of virtual memory. I don't use any software. I use Claymore to apply overclocks. When I set the memory to 2000 it runs at 29.6 Mh/s without problem which fine but it has samsung memory and I'd like to try see what it can do. BIOS is unchanged except for memory straps.
